Kenmare Crescent is a mix of semi-detached houses and detached houses. Homes here typically change hands around £108,975 — roughly 32% below the DN21 norm. Per square metre of floor space it comes to about £1,691, below the district's £1,758. Too few recent sales to read a street-level trend, but across DN21 prices have been rising over the last few years. HM Land Registry records 16 sales across 10 homes since 2001 — homes here come up rarely.

Kenmare Crescent's £108,975 median sits about 32% below DN21's £160,000; on floor space it runs £1,691/m² against the district's £1,758/m² (-4%).
Street and DN21 figures are medians of HM Land Registry sales; the England figures are the UK House Price Index mix-adjusted average — a different basis, so compare direction rather than levels between the two.
